The tag line for the Sheru Classic is ‘Be There,’ and now we will have an idea who will fit into that category. In its second year, the show has moved from Mumbai to Delhi and will be held on October 5 and 6 – right after the Mr. Olympia as it was in 2011. IFBB pro Sheru Aangrish did a masterful job last fall and the venue will be much larger and appeal to the masses of his native country.
The celebrity A-listers in Bollywood last year were the main focus in an intimate setting of 1,100. But Aangrish is taking it up more than just a notch and the contest will be held in India’s largest indoor venue, Indhira Ghandi, with a capacity of 20,000. That number will be larger than the Olympia and Arnold Classic crowd combined and Aangrish expects a sell out.
